4.12 TOWING

It is not recommended that this machine be towed, except in the
event of an emergency such as a machine malfunction or a total
machine power failure.

Electric Brake Release

NOTE: Electrical release of the brakes requires enough battery
power to hold the brakes in released mode until destina-
tion is reached.
1. Chock wheels or secure machine with tow vehicle.
2. Power up machine in ground mode on the ground control
station (1).
3. The brake release switch (2) is located on the lower rear
panel (3).
4. Depress the brake release switch once to release brakes.
5. When finished towing depress brake release switch again or
power machine down at the ground control station to re-
engage the brakes.
NOTE: Any action to remove electrical power from the brakes
such as, depressing the ground control emergency stop
switch, or switching the key switch to OFF or PLATFORM
MODE will re-engage the brakes.

Mechanical Brake Release

1. Chock wheels or secure machine with tow vehicle.
2. At the ground control station power machine down by press-
ing the E-Stop switch in.
3. Remove the two cover bolts (1), cover (2), and cover o-
ring seal (3) from the back of drive motor unit.
